Eagle Specialty Products: The Standard in High-Performance Rotating Assemblies
Eagle Specialty Products has been at the forefront of high-performance engine building since its founding in 1992. Eagle set out with a singular mission: to engineer the strongest, most reliable bottom-end components on the market, and decades of development went into their product line before a single rod was ever sold. Today, the brand is widely recognized as the largest aftermarket connecting rod manufacturer in the world, with a global dealer network spanning over 7,000 distributors.
Eagle's reputation is built on an uncompromising approach to materials and manufacturing. The brand uses only certified steel in production, and every component undergoes multi-stage heat treating, sonic testing, magna-fluxing, and x-ray inspection to guarantee reliability under extreme stress. A Complete Bottom-End Solution
At the heart of Eagle's lineup are their legendary engine connecting rods, offered in several tiers to suit every power level. The budget-friendly SIR forged 5140 steel I-Beam rods are ideal for naturally aspirated builds, while the ESP H-Beam rods — forged from ASME-certified 4340 chromoly steel — are the go-to choice for high-horsepower engines running boost, nitrous, or exotic fuels. The latest 4th-generation 4D H-Beam rods take it even further with 100% CNC machining on every surface, 7/16" ARP 2000 bolts as standard equipment, and a proprietary steel alloy developed over 30 years of research.
Eagle's engine crankshafts round out the rotating assembly with the same tiered philosophy — from cast steel street replacements to forged 4140 and full 4340 competition units. Eagle uses Hines computerized balancers and trained technicians to ensure every crankshaft meets precise tolerances, and their forged cranks feature generously sized fillet radiuses for improved fatigue resistance over OEM pieces.
For builders who want a complete solution, Eagle's engine rebuild kits bundle a crank, rods, pistons, rings, and bearings into a single, test-fitted rotating assembly. These kits span from Street & Strip packages for pump-gas daily drivers all the way to full Competition and Heavy-Duty assemblies designed for extreme boost and high-RPM use. Eagle partners with top piston suppliers including Mahle, JE/SRP, CP/Arias, and others to deliver a complete, cohesive build in one order.
Rounding out the lineup are Eagle's engine connecting rod bolts — manufactured by ARP to Eagle's own specifications. These are purpose-engineered fasteners, not off-the-shelf items, ensuring the critical rod-cap joint is held to the precise tolerances Eagle's designs demand.
Broad Application Coverage
Eagle was the first aftermarket manufacturer to expand aggressively into import and domestic platforms alike. Their catalog covers engines from Chevrolet small block and LS, Ford, Chrysler, Pontiac, Honda, Toyota, Nissan, Mitsubishi, Subaru, and many more — with new applications added every year. That breadth, combined with Eagle's massive in-house inventory, allows the brand to ship the vast majority of orders the same day they are placed.
